One of the primary benefits of using a small animal incinerator is the convenience it offers. Rather than having to transport animal remains to a landfill or burial site, a small incinerator allows for on-site disposal. This can save time, money, and resources while also reducing the risk of spreading disease or attracting scavengers. With a small incinerator, you can quickly and easily dispose of animal carcasses in a controlled and sanitary manner.
Another key benefit of using a small animal incinerator is the efficiency it provides. These units are designed to safely and effectively burn organic materials, including animal remains, at high temperatures. This results in complete and thorough incineration, leaving behind only a small amount of sterile ash. This process not only eliminates the need for additional waste disposal but also reduces the risk of contamination and odors associated with traditional disposal methods.

Furthermore, small animal incinerators are designed with safety in mind. These units are equipped with advanced features such as temperature controls, air filtration systems, and automatic shut-off mechanisms to ensure a safe and controlled incineration process. This reduces the risk of accidents, fires, or emissions that can occur with open-air burning or other disposal methods.
